Visakhapatnam: Six Maoists surrender before SP arms

Visakhapatnam: Six Maoists surrendered before the Vizag Rural police on Monday.

Among them, two are from Pedabayalu Area Committee of CPI Maoists in Andhra-Odisha-Border (AOB) area and the other four are hardcore militia members.

SP (Rural) Babuji Attada identified the six as G. Birusu, 24, G. Ramayya, 25, K. Satti Babu, 37, G. Satyanarayana, 19, K. Ganapati, 40, and K. Pethro, 19.

They were fed up with their ideologies and surrendered before the police. Birusu was involved in one murder and four other offences, while Ramayya played a key role in three murders as well as planting landmines at Cheekupanasa village at the time of general elections. Ganapathi and Pethro committed two murders each.

The SP has assured that the police will not frame any cases against the surrendered Maoists. He gave a call for other Maoists cadres also to join the mainstream.

Mr Babjee said that there are more than 150 cadres in the AOB area, including persons from Odisha and Chhattisgarh.

The militia members have surrendered mainly to get back into the mainstream and they have given back the weapons to the Maoist leaders. All of them would be rehabilitated as per the government policy for surrendering Naxalites.
